Career Advancement Programme in Podcasting Relaxation (Advanced)
-- viewing nowThe Career Advancement Programme in Podcasting Relaxation is an advanced certificate programme comprising 20 units, designed to equip learners with essential skills for career advancement in the rapidly growing podcasting industry. As the demand for high-quality audio content continues to rise, this programme provides learners with the knowledge and expertise to produce engaging, professionally-sounding podcasts that cater to diverse audiences.
